DescriptionAs a Marketing Coordinator on the new Foundational Marketing Programs team within the AWS Product Marketing (PMM) and Thought Leadership (TL) organization, you will play a critical role in supporting the evolving needs of both product marketing managers (PMMs) and product managers (PMs).This team provides strategic, scalable support across the organization for launches, content refreshes, and other special projects related to the product marketing roadmap that require program management support. This position offers unique exposure to the key role a PMM plays in our organization, and learning and development paths are currently being constructed to support a future transition into this space.Successful candidates will be detail-oriented, organized, and capable of handling multiple projects at once.Key job responsibilitiesManage effective processes and workflows to improve efficiency and adaptability within the PMM and TL orgCollaborate closely with PMMs, PMs, and stakeholder teams to support the execution of Tier 1 product launches year-round and for large-scale events—including tracking key deadlines, deliverables, and action itemsEnsure product marketing content is regularly refreshed and up-to-dateLeverage Adobe Workfront to streamline request management and fulfillmentMaintain team documents such a standard operating procedure (SOPs) and wikisA day in the lifeAbout the teamDiverse ExperiencesAWS values diverse experiences.
